Old School Content Developer Not Ready To Collaborate
Michael Eisner, the former Disney chief and current head of Vuguru, speaking in New York yesterday, showed little interest in bringing brands into the development process of his firm's short-form online programming. "I have never produced anything in my career with an audience in mind," he said. [People] are saying the internet is made up of 13-year-olds, so gear toward them. But I just don't think you should. Ch-ch-ch-ch-Changes
In an animated discussion with Washington Post editors and reporters yesterday, Microsoft chief executive Steve Ballmer offered his far-ranging views of upcoming changes in technology and the media. Here's a slice: Q. What is your outlook for the future of media? A. In the next 10 years, the whole world of media, communications and advertising are going to be turned upside down -- my opinion.
